Full Description
December 2011. Historic Building Recording.
Record made of redundant agricultural buildings prior to their proposed conversion.
The main barn was used for threshing cereals and is constructed from flint with brick quoins with a clay pantile roof. The small barn is constructed from clay lump with a pantile roof and has been used more recently for storage and as a stables.
